Output 74294703ae63b0d593ec5914010fd59e99fb124d80bd4f0fe6448cfbe90c4533:8

value
6094803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 198c93c390591a7d118a325c6c1980c061e57248 OP_EQUAL
address
3427DpDFC5844cFGSsZ6ggD86nzEKmaP2b
transaction
74294703ae63b0d593ec5914010fd59e99fb124d80bd4f0fe6448cfbe90c4533
spent
true